Full-time Posted June 04, 2026
Apply Now

Job Description

Responsibilities

  • Manage timelines/deliverables within the team towards the successful delivery of projects.
  • Design software solutions by interacting with portfolio managers, traders, operations staff and peers to understand requirements.
  • Develop solutions that are in line with the client's technology biases, deliver efficiency and scalability, and enable new trading activities.
  • Provide knowledge transfer to team members and support staff through application demos, walkthroughs, and documentation.

Skills Must have

  • Prior consulting, advisory, or client-facing delivery experience
  • Ability to operate effectively in ambiguous environments
  • Proven independent delivery without close supervision
  • Strong Java experience in enterprise environments + Knowledge in Python (2 years)
  • Experience with SQL queries, Docker/Kubernetes
  • Strong cloud experience (AWS)
  • Strong unit and i...

Apply for This Position

Ready to take the next step? Click the button below to submit your application.

Submit Application